After about an hour of bending it (it luckily never work-hardened and broke) into a variety of positions, I re-thought the design, and came up with one that works. Here are some photos that should help guide you.
Make sure you bend ONLY the straight part of the ramp(the _ part that deviates from the smooth C_ shape) and not any of the curved circle. Bending behind the transition from linear to curved can make your petcock leak in some positions because it makes the arm that presses on the pin most of the time.
